Job Summary

The Manager, R&D Business Operations provides operational and analytical support to R&D business functions, with primary responsibility for the creation, generation, and management of purchase orders following contract execution within enterprise systems (e.g., Ariba/SAP). This role ensures accurate translation of executed contracts into purchase orders, maintains financial alignment with approved budgets, and supports compliant, efficient, and cost-effective financial operations.

The Manager partners cross-functionally with R&D stakeholders, Legal, Global Strategic Sourcing, Finance, Accounts Payable, and external vendors to ensure timely PO issuance, proper system documentation, and adherence to internal controls and financial policies.

The Manager works independently in managing purchase order workflows and system processes, operating with moderate autonomy while escalating complex financial, compliance, or risk-related matters as appropriate.

Essential Functions of the Job, include:
  • Create, generate, and manage purchase orders in Ariba/SAP following full contract execution, ensuring alignment with contract terms, budgets, and approved scopes of work in compliance with company policies and service level standard turnaround times.
  • Translate contractual payment terms, milestones, and fee structures into accurate and compliant purchase order structures.
  • Review executed agreements to ensure proper financial setup, including funding allocations, payment schedules, and budget tracking.
  • Process and manage change orders, PO amendments, closures, and funding adjustments in accordance with contract modifications.
  • Partner with R&D, Finance, and Strategic Sourcing to ensure timely PO issuance and resolution of system or budget discrepancies.
  • Monitor purchase order lifecycle activities, including invoice matching, goods receipt confirmations, accrual support, and PO reconciliation.
  • Ensure compliance with internal financial controls, delegation of authority policies, and procurement procedures prior to PO release.
  • Serve as system subject matter expert (SME) for Ariba/SAP purchase order workflows and provide guidance to internal stakeholders.
  • Train business partners on purchase requisition and PO processes, including proper documentation and system requirements.
  • Facilitate weekly or monthly operational status meetings related to PO issuance, budget tracking, and financial metrics as appropriate.
  • Generate reports and dashboards to track PO cycle times, open commitments, spend against budget, and operational KPIs.
  • Support month-end and year-end close activities, including accrual validation and financial reconciliation.
  •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ance PO accuracy, system efficiency, and compliance with internal policies and external regulations.
  • Support audit requests and compliance reviews related to procurement and purchase order activities.
